Condor is going to be Feb 26-28. I'm looking for GMs for rpgs and boardgames. If you are interested please PM me with this information:
Name of Game:
Game System:
Day:
Time:
Length:
Number of Players:
Experience of Players:
Note: Basic four hour time slots look like this: 9-1, 2-6, 7:30-11:30. If you run 48 players hours you get in free (two game with 6 players for 4 hours).
If you have any questions please PM me or post them here.
More information on Condor can be found here:http://www.condorcon.org/events/gaming.html

[quote="cczernia"]Awww... memories. And just like Strategicon it is the RPGA who dictates the timeslots.[/quote]
Well, in the case of Strategicon, the RPGA had its timeslots, and Mike Fryer decided to line up two of the non-RPGA timeslots with them to encourage cross-pollination. I don't think the RPGA can really have any say over when a non-RPGA or organized-play game starts and stops, but it's good to keep them aligned for the same reason.

If I can get my shit together by then, maybe I'll run that Star Wars droid freedom-fighters game Andy and I were talking about a few weeks ago. The PCs are part of the Droid Liberation Army, a galaxy-wide guerrilla organization committed to freeing droids from the yoke of the oppressor's restraining bolt. The one-shot would be about hitting a droid factory, taking out the meatbags, and reprogramming the central computer to make all the droids independent.
Star Wars: Kill All Humans!

pretty awesome con, cczernia! props for putting the gaming program together. here's the breakdown for those who couldn't make it:
no one showed for my talisman game-- boo!
but, i got to play in a goodman games playtest; a treatment of 3.x d&d modified to feel like d&d basic (think microlite20 if was geared towards grognardy dungeon crawls). a blast! run by none other than joseph goodman himself-- yay!!
three people showed up to my star trek rpg game. deaddogg and his wife (who incidentally were excellent pc's!) were there among them-- yay!!
i had a great time. would definitely go again, and i wish i wasn't working tomorrow. i heartily recommend it for those who can't make it out to the cons outside san diego.
